Met Office issues strong winds and rain warning for Wales
- Published

Exposed coasts in the south west are likely to be the worst hit
Strong winds and heavy rain are expected to hit Wales on Saturday, the Met Office has warned.
Gusts of 40-50mph (64-80km/h) are forecast for some inland areas, with potentially more than 60mph (96km/h) on exposed coasts and hills.
The yellow "be aware" alert, external covering the whole of Wales also warned the bad weather could cause travel disruption - mainly in the south and east.
The warning is in place from 06:00 GMT to 19:00.
